Abstract
<p>(A) Relative numbers of spermatogenic cell types/1000 Sertoli cells in testes of 4 month old wildtype and transgenic <i>DAZL</i>-deficient rats (+/−SEM, n = 3 rats/group). Undifferentiated type A spermatogonia (Undif), differentiating type A spermatogonia (Type A), intermediate to type B spermatogonia (Int-Type B), preleptotene spermatocytes (PL), leptotene-zygotene spermatocytes (lept-zygo), pachytene-diplotene spermatocytes (Pachy-Di), secondary spermatocytes-round spermatids (SS-RS), elongating spermatids (ES). Significant differences (i.e. p<0.05) in testis cell types scored in wildtype and DAZL-deficient rats were determined for SS-RS (p = 0.022) and ES (p<0.0001) using unpaired two-tailed students t-test. (B) Histological cross-sections of seminiferous tubules from 4 month old wildtype (<i>Top left</i>) and transgenic <i>DAZL</i>-deficient rats (<i>Top right</i>). <i>Bottom left and right</i> show higher magnification images of boxed regions in the <i>Top</i> panels. Scale bars = 100 µm. (C) Images of spermatogonial types in testis sections from wildtype rats at stages VIII, XI, XIII, XIV, II and V of spermatogenesis. Types of undifferentiated (Undif) and differentiating spermatogonia (A1, A2, A3, A4, Int, B) were determined by analysis of staining patterns in nuclei at specific stages of spermatogenesis. Scale bar = 30 µm. (D) Images of spermatogonial types in testis sections from <i>DAZL</i>-deficient rats. Because stages of the epithelial cycle could not be classified in these rats, types of undifferentiated (Undif) and differentiating spermatogonia (A1-like, A2-like, A3-like, A4-like, Int-like, B-like) were estimated based on staining profiles of spermatogonia in wildtype rats. Scale bar = 30 µm.</p
